작성
·
142
·
수정됨
0
저번 질문이 많이 도움이 되었습니다. 그래서 같은 대역의 PC 2개를 가지고
하나는 kafka 서버로 만들어서 ssh로 연결이 되었고 여러 명령들도 잘 실행되었습니다.
이번엔 java code로 만들어본 simpleproducer를 이용하여 메세지를 보내보고싶은데
IP 부분의 code를 어떻게 설정하면 좋을까요?
kafka 서버의 PC의 ip는 210.110.32.125 이고 포트번호는 12345로 포트 포워딩을 통해 22번 변경했습니다
Properties props = new Properties();
//bootstrap.servers, key.serializer.class, value.serializer.class
//props.setProperty("bootstrap.servers", "192.168.56.101:9092");
props.setProperty(ProducerConfig.BOOTSTRAP_SERVERS_CONFIG, "192.168.56.101:9092");
답변 1
1
지난번 구성이 잘 되었다니 다행이군요.
외부에서는 210.110.32.125:9092 로 입력해 줘야 합니다. 그리고 210.110.32.125 의 9092 포트가 192.168.56.101: 9092 포트 포워딩 되게 설정해 줘야 합니다.
감사합니다.
완벽하게 연결 되었습니다 감사합니다.